Transaction 2d750fb000475802814c185944e1ce6cfe864b6c363606c95b87d266e260790a

3 Input
2 Outputs
  • 2d750fb000475802814c185944e1ce6cfe864b6c363606c95b87d266e260790a:0
  • value  302600000
    address  19KRyb39ossASTbT9Rz61b4jD1Fqe29cmv
  • 2d750fb000475802814c185944e1ce6cfe864b6c363606c95b87d266e260790a:1
  • value  13426138
    address  1MQfAAP9sAmkHtEtpHvmvbvJjoN4mbtY4M